How to Find Cheaper Shipping from China to Germany

Shipping products from China to Germany can be a cost-effective solution for businesses looking to import goods. However, understanding how to find cheaper shipping options can make a significant difference in your overall expenses. Below are several strategies that can help you navigate the complexities of international shipping and save money in the process.

1. Evaluate Different Shipping Methods

There are various shipping methods available, each with its own cost structure. Understanding these methods can help you choose the most economical option:

  • Air Freight: While typically faster, air freight can be expensive. Consider it for smaller shipments or urgent deliveries.
  • Sea Freight: Ideal for large volumes, shipping by sea is generally more economical than air freight. However, it takes longer to arrive.
  • Express Services: Companies like DHL or FedEx offer express shipping, which is quick but often comes with a premium price. Only use this for urgent needs.

2. Consolidate Your Shipments

Consolidating your shipments can lead to significant savings. By combining several smaller shipments into one larger shipment, you can take advantage of bulk shipping rates:

  • Consider using freight forwarders who specialize in consolidation services.
  • Work with suppliers to schedule deliveries that align with your shipment needs.

3. Compare Different Freight Forwarders

Not all freight forwarders offer the same rates, so it’s important to shop around:

  • Request quotes from multiple freight forwarders to compare prices.
  • Check reviews and ask for recommendations to find reliable services.
  • Look for forwarders that specialize in China-Germany routes, as they may have better rates and experience.

4. Understand Incoterms and Choose Wisely

Incoterms govern shipping responsibilities and costs between buyers and sellers. Familiarizing yourself with these terms can help you control costs:

  • FOB (Free On Board): The seller pays for transport to a specified port. Once on board, the buyer is responsible.
  • CIF (Cost, Insurance, and Freight): The seller covers costs up to the destination port, which can simplify budgeting.
  • Choose terms that minimize your overall expenses while providing you the security you need for your shipments.

In addition to these strategies, staying informed about regulations and duties associated with importing goods from China to Germany can also help you avoid unexpected costs. Regulatory challenges can add to overhead, making it essential to familiarize yourself with the legal landscape. Consult with professionals if needed.

By carefully considering your shipping methods, consolidating shipments, comparing freight forwarders, and understanding incoterms, you can significantly reduce the costs associated with shipping from China to Germany. This not only improves your bottom line but also enhances the overall efficiency of your supply chain.

Types of Shipping Methods

There are several shipping methods available for transporting goods from China to Germany. Each has its benefits and drawbacks regarding cost, speed, and convenience:

  • Sea Freight: This is one of the most cost-effective options for bulk shipments. Though slower, it is ideal for large volumes of goods. Optimal for non-time-sensitive shipments, sea freight helps reduce costs significantly.
  • Air Freight: While not as cheap as sea freight, air freight is considerably faster and is best suited for urgent shipments. It is a good option for smaller, high-value items where speed is essential.
  • Express Shipping: Companies like DHL, FedEx, and UPS offer express shipping that guarantees quick delivery. This method is the most expensive and should be used when your priority is speed over cost.
  • Rail Freight: An emerging option for shipping between China and Europe, rail freight offers a good balance of cost and speed. It is less expensive than air freight and faster than sea freight.

Understanding Total Shipping Costs

While the base rate of transporting your goods is critical, it’s essential to consider the total costs. Poor planning can lead to hidden expenses that negate initial savings.

  • Customs Duties: Research the customs duties based on the goods you're importing to Germany. Knowing the regulations will help you estimate the total cost accurately.
  • Insurance: While not mandatory, insuring your goods is smart, especially for high-value shipments. This can add to your overall cost but provides peace of mind.
  • Handling Fees: Many shipping companies charge additional fees for loading, unloading, and warehousing. Make sure to inquire about these when comparing quotes.
  • Delivery Times: Take into account delivery schedules, as longer shipping times may necessitate additional warehousing costs in Germany.

Top Tips for Achieving Cheaper Shipping China Germany Rates

Shipping goods from China to Germany can be expensive, but there are several strategies you can employ to lower your costs. Understanding the shipping process and exploring various options can lead to significant savings. Here are some effective tips to help you achieve cheaper shipping rates.

1. Choose the Right Shipping Method

The shipping method you select has a considerable impact on the overall cost. Here are some common methods:

  • Air Freight: Fast but often expensive, air freight is best for high-value or time-sensitive shipments.
  • Sea Freight: More economical for large volumes, sea freight is ideal for non-urgent goods. It allows for more weight compared to air freight.
  • Rail Freight: Increasing in popularity, rail freight offers a balance between speed and cost, especially for shipments within Europe.

Assess your needs and choose the method that best aligns with your budget and timeline.

2. Optimize Your Packaging

Effective packaging is crucial in minimizing shipping costs. Consider the following packaging tips:

  • Reduce Volume: Use smaller boxes to minimize dimensional weight, which is often used in shipping calculations.
  • Use Lightweight Materials: Select packing materials that are durable yet lightweight to reduce weight-based shipping fees.
  • Consolidate Shipments: If possible, group multiple items into one shipment to take advantage of bulk rates.

By optimizing packaging, you not only reduce costs but also enhance the safety of your goods during transit.

3. Explore Different Freight Forwarders

Freight forwarders play a crucial role in getting your goods from point A to point B. To find cheaper shipping rates, keep this in mind:

  • Compare Rates: Reach out to multiple freight forwarders and compare their quotes to find the best deal.
  • Negotiate Terms: Don’t hesitate to negotiate prices or request discounts, especially if you're a repeat customer.
  • Read Reviews: Choose a reliable forwarder by reading customer reviews and considering their experience in the China-Germany route.

Finding the right freight forwarder can significantly impact your shipping expenses.

4. Be Aware of Customs Regulations

Understanding customs procedures can prevent unforeseen costs and delays:

  • Know Tariffs: Familiarize yourself with import tariffs and any applicable regulations when sending goods to Germany.
  • Prepare Documentation: Ensure that all shipping documents are correctly completed to avoid delays that could lead to additional fees.
  • Consider Duties: Factor in customs duties when calculating total expenses to ensure you stay within budget.

By being proactive about customs regulations, you can avoid unnecessary expenses that could inflate your overall shipping costs.

By implementing these tips, you can achieve significantly cheaper shipping from China to Germany. With careful planning, smart packaging, and the right partnerships, your shipping process can not only be more affordable but also more efficient, providing peace of mind as your goods travel across the globe.
